MICHEL 570
HELDENGEDENKTAG
(Soldier / Memorial Day)

These 2 stamps were issued on 15th March 1935 and were valid through 31st December 1936. Hans Schweitzer designed these 'steel helmets' in remembrance of the dead from the First World War. Memorial Day was previously observed on November 13th each year but Hitler changed the name of the day from "War Memorial Day" to "War Heroes Memorial Day" and moved the date to 16th March each year. The stamps were produced on coated paper on sheets (10x10), with swastika watermark, Perf K 14 and are either type 'x' (with vertical gum rippling) or type 'y' (with horizontal gum rippling).

Mi 570
12Pf
dark brownish carmine


Valid until: 31st Dec 1936. Quantities: Unknown
